- The distance between Himeji, Japan and Jakobshavn, Greenland is approximately 8,436 km or 5,242 mi.
- To reach Himeji in this distance one would set out from Jakobshavn bearing 355.1°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Himeji bearing 182.1° or S .
- Himeji has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Jakobshavn has a tundra climate (ET).
- The annual mean temperature is 19 °C (34.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.2 °C (0.4°F) more in Himeji.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1061 mm (41.8 in) more which is equivalent to 1061 l/m² (26.04 US gal/ft²) or 10,610,000 l/ha (1,134,279 US gal/ac) more. About 5 1/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 34.3° higher in Himeji than in Jakobshavn.
- Relative humidity levels are 0.1%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 18°C (32.5°F) higher.
